Philadelphia Man Charged with Murder After Alleged Domestic Violence Incident
2/10/2026, 9:56:28 PM
Fatal Shooting Incident
Yujun Ren, a 32-year-old man from Philadelphia, has been charged with criminal homicide, possession of an instrument of crime, and stalking following the fatal shooting of his ex-girlfriend, Yuan Yuan Lu, in Levittown, Pennsylvania. The incident occurred early Sunday morning, just one day after Lu filed a police report alleging that Ren had sexually assaulted her. According to the Bucks County District Attorney’s Office, Ren tracked Lu to her vehicle and shot her while she was seated inside.
Background of Domestic Violence Allegations
On the day prior to the shooting, Lu reported to the Philadelphia Police Department that Ren had assaulted her at his home. She expressed her intention to end the relationship and was in the process of packing her belongings when Ren was at work. Lu had also communicated her fear of Ren, stating that he carried a firearm at all times. Investigators later confirmed that Ren legally owned a Mossberg MC20 9mm pistol.
Details of the Shooting
Authorities discovered Lu's body in the driver's seat of her Hyundai, with a gunshot wound to the head. A spent shell casing was found at the scene, and damage to the vehicle's window indicated gunfire. Ren turned himself in to the Middletown Township police later that day, claiming the shooting was accidental. He stated that he pulled the gun from his waistband to scare Lu after she allegedly made hurtful comments and took their pets.
Official Statements and Community Impact
Bucks County District Attorney Joe Khan emphasized the dangers of domestic violence, stating, “Today’s tragic event is a sobering reminder of the lethal nature of domestic violence.” He expressed a commitment to seeking justice for Lu. The local community has reacted with shock, with neighbors describing Lu as a kind person and expressing disbelief that such violence could occur in their neighborhood.

What's Next
Ren has been arraigned and denied bail, with a preliminary hearing scheduled for Tuesday. The case is expected to draw significant attention as it unfolds, particularly regarding the broader implications for domestic violence awareness and prevention efforts in Pennsylvania and beyond.
